Momentive Announces Site Selection of New Technology Center and Global Headquarters

February 11, 2010
For Release: February 11, 2010
Contact: John Scharf 518.233.3893
 
ALBANY, NY — Momentive Performance Materials Inc. announced today that the Rensselaer Technology Park located on Route 4 in North Greenbush, NY has been selected as the site for its state-of-the-art Technology Center and Global Headquarters.

Construction of the Technology Center, which will be financed in part by a developer, is expected to begin in late 2010 and will result in approximately 150 construction-related jobs. The Company is in the process of preparing a detailed bid package and will be soliciting bids, later in the year, from developers. The Rensselaer Technology Park is associated with the Rensselaer Polytechnic Institute (“Rensselaer”).

The new facilities will employ 250 people with a total annual payroll of approximately $38 million. The Technology Center will cost approximately $75 million and will employ 130 people. The Company’s global headquarters building will be constructed following completion of the Technology Center at a cost of approximately $16 million. The headquarters will employ 120 people. It is expected that approximately 125 of the jobs will be new to the Capital Region, in addition to 25 positions Momentive has already added to its global headquarters. Momentive relocated its global headquarters from Wilton, CT to the Capital Region on August 1, 2008. The Company’s interim global headquarters is located at 22 Corporate Woods Boulevard in Albany, NY.

About Momentive
Momentive is a global leader in silicones and advanced materials, with a 70-year heritage of being first to market with performance applications for major industries that support and improve everyday life. The company delivers the science behind the solutions, by linking custom technology platforms to opportunities for customers. Momentive Performance Materials Inc. is controlled by an affiliate of Apollo Management, L.P. Additional information is available at www.momentive.com.
